Symptom:
VEHICLE BODY STYLE MISMATCH
When Monitored and Set Condition:
VEHICLE BODY STYLE MISMATCH
When Monitored: When the ignition is on, theACM monitors the PCI Bus for the vehicle
body style message from the Powertrain Control Module.
Set Condition: With ignition on, If the ACM does not receive the vehicle Body Style
messages on the bus the code will set.
POSSIBLE CAUSES
PCM, PCI COMMUNICATION FAILURE
WRONG OR MISSING BUS MESSAGE
WRONG VIN OR MISSING VIN
ACM, VEHICLE BODY STYLE MISMATCH
STORED CODE OR INTERMITTENT CONDITION
ACTIVE CODE PRESENT
TEST ACTION APPLICABILITY
1 Turn the ignition on.
Ensure the battery is fully charged.
NOTE: For the purpose of this test, the AECM and ORC modules will be
referred to as an ACM.
SELECT ACTIVE or STORED DTC:
All
ACM - ACTIVE DTC
Go To 2
ACM - STORED DTC
Go To 6
NOTE: When reconnecting Airbag system components, the ignition must be
turned off and the battery must be disconnected.
2 Turn the ignition on.
Connect the DRBIIIt to the data link connector and select PASSIVE RESTRAINTS,
AIRBAG, SYSTEM TEST.
With the DRBIIIt, read the PCM Active on the Bus:.
Does the DRB show PCM ACTIVE ON THE BUS:?
All
Yes Go To 3
No Refer to category COMMUNICATION CATEGORY and select the
related symptom.
Perform __AIRBAG VERIFICATION TEST - VER 1.
